Sam Holdings Revenue
Sam Holdings had revenue of 1.54T VND in the quarter ending September 30, 2025, with 67.62% growth. This brings the company's revenue in the last twelve months to 4.97T, up 26.57% year-over-year. In the year 2024, Sam Holdings had annual revenue of 4.04T with 83.55% growth.

Revenue Definition
Revenue, also called sales, is the amount of money a company receives from its business activities, such as sales of products or services. Revenue does not take any expenses into account and is therefore different from profits.
